The Center for Systems Imaging Core is an Emory University School of Medicine Core Facility, directed by Dr. John Oshinski. The goals of this center are to:

(1) support the advancement of scientific research focused on the development of imaging biomarkers;

(2) promote the development and application of biomedical imaging technology particularly magnetic resonance imaging

(3) provide Core services for animal and human imaging studies;

(4) to build cross-cutting educational and training programs.
